Tip #7: Make lists on your blog.
Similar to tutorials and how-to articles, lists make for terrific blog posts and are used liberally by the best bloggers on the web. Simple lists are great for just about every blog. You could provide a list of anything that interests you and fits your blog’s subject matter and audience. A list could be as simple as the top 10 books you read this year, plan to read next year, or that are related directly to your blog niche. Let your imagination and creativity guide you!

Tip #8: Use a guest blogger.
Another way to invigorate your blog is to feature a guest post. If you can score an influential guest to post on your blog, chances are that they will also bring some of their own fans to your blog. Even if you can’t find someone well-known within your niche, having a guest writer with a different writing style or something new to add will bring interest to your blog.

Tip #9: Create a special video blog.
A fun way to add some interesting content to your blog is to create the occasional video blog post. You can have the video hosted directly on your site, or you can have YouTube or Vimeo host the video, which can then be embedded on your site.

Tip #10: Write an interview.
Find someone well-known in your niche and contact them to see if you can do an interview. Many people will be delighted to give you an interview, but make sure you prepare ahead of time. If time permits, you can even announce the event on your blog in advance and let some of your readers come up with questions.

Tip #11: Live blog from an event.
Attending a conference or even heading out on vacation? This could be a perfect opportunity to blog live. Talk about the event, promote it on Twitter and Facebook, and encourage your readers to interact on your blog. Record video, upload photos and do some interviews as well, and you can use these in later posts.

Tip #12: Reevaluate your blog.
If you’ve tried the tips above and your blog is still not attracting new readers, it may be time for a complete overhaul. You can remain within your niche, but you might have to reevaluate the keywords that you are using in your content and the subject matter of your blog. Sometimes changing a few keywords to less-competitive ones can do wonders.
